Is there a limit to the number of resources that can be edited to a Foundry Branch?
I am cleaning up our ontology and want to confirm if there are concerns with modifying a large number of object types and actions on a single branch.

Theoretically no! The UI is not paginated at the moment however and will only show 100 “resources”. This is fine since in almost every case all changes to a single ontology are considered a single “resource”.
The one thing to consider here is that even if the changes are simple, the more that you add → the more complex that the review process can be. Specifically finding the subset of users required to approve all changes across all resources.
